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. ioBroker Allgemein
    4. Achtung!!! Nicht über admin updaten !!

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    Achtung!!! Nicht über admin updaten !!

    This topic has been deleted. Only users with topic management privileges can see it.
    • Bluefox
      Bluefox last edited by

      Aktuelles iobroker.js-controller setzt beim Update von sich selbst alle Rechte auf 777.

      Bitte nächste Version manuell oder über git pull updaten.

      1 Reply Last reply Reply Quote 0
      • Homoran
        Homoran Global Moderator Administrators last edited by

        Über git pull geht es nicht, wenn man vorher mit npm installiert hat, oder??

        egal, ich habe mir ein Installationsscript als install.sh geschrieben und starte es von root aus.

        apt-get update
        apt-get upgrade -y
        wget http://download.iobroker.org/nodejs_0.10.22-1_armhf.deb
        dpkg -i nodejs_0.10.22-1_armhf.deb
        rm nodejs_0.10.22-1_armhf.deb
        mkdir /opt/iobroker
        cd /opt/iobroker
        npm install iobroker.js-controller
        npm install iobroker.hm-rega
        npm install iobroker.history
        npm install iobroker.rickshaw
        npm install iobroker.dwd
        npm install iobroker.vis
        npm install iobroker.node-red
        cd node_modules/iobroker.js-controller
        chmod +x iobroker
        ./iobroker start 
        

        den schiebe ich nach dem Neu-Aufsetzen der SD-Card ins root verzeichnis und rufe ihn dort auf

        ist nur noch ein Befehl, der Rest läuft automatisch.

        Lediglich EINE Fehlermeldung kam:

        npm ERR! fetch failed https://registry.npmjs.org/range-parser/-/range-parser-1.0.2.tgz
        

        Super Leistung, sogar die Adapter lassen sich fertig installieren.

        EDIT: Leider doch nicht, sind im Reiter "Adapter" zwar als installiert gekennzeichnet, aber unter "Instanzen" nicht zu finden???
        144_iobroker_admin_adapter_npm.jpg
        und beim Nachinstallieren eines "weiteren" Adapters bekam dieser die extension .0!!
        144_iobroker_admin_instancesr_npm.jpg

        Gruß

        Rainer

        1 Reply Last reply Reply Quote 0
        • Bluefox
          Bluefox last edited by

          "npm install iobroker.adapter" Installiert den adapter nicht in system, sondert lädt den nur runter. Adapter muss immer noch mit "iobroker add adapter" hinzugefügt werden.

          Man kann aber überlegen, wie man das besser machen kann. 😉

          1 Reply Last reply Reply Quote 0
          • Homoran
            Homoran Global Moderator Administrators last edited by

            Danke für die schnelle Antwort.

            Dann also in dem Installationsscript z.B. hinter:

            'npm install iobroker.hm-rega'

            noch ein 'node ioBroker add hm-rega –enabled'

            oder??

            Gruß

            Rainer

            1 Reply Last reply Reply Quote 0
            • Bluefox
              Bluefox last edited by

              @Homoran:

              Danke für die schnelle Antwort.

              Dann also in dem Installationsscript z.B. hinter:

              'npm install iobroker.hm-rega'

              noch ein 'node ioBroker add hm-rega –enabled'

              oder??

              Gruß

              Rainer `
              Ja.

              1 Reply Last reply Reply Quote 0
              • Bluefox
                Bluefox last edited by

                Bitte vor dem Update lib/setup.js editieren:

                Zeile 1064

                var cmd = 'chmod 777 * -R ' + dir;
                
                

                auf

                var cmd = 'chmod 777 -R ' + dir;
                

                und updaten.

                1 Reply Last reply Reply Quote 0
                • Homoran
                  Homoran Global Moderator Administrators last edited by

                  Das gilt für die Version 0.3.13??

                  bei der Version 0.3.14 ist dies (bei mir) in Zeile 1067 (dort auch ändern??)

                  unter /opt/iobroker/node_modules/iobroker.js-controller/lib

                  wobei /opt/iobroker aus Gewohnheit mein Installationsverzeichnis ist

                  Gruß

                  Rainer
                  305_betriebsstundenzaehler_070.txt

                  1 Reply Last reply Reply Quote 0
                  • Bluefox
                    Bluefox last edited by

                    @Homoran:

                    Das gilt für die Version 0.3.13??

                    bei der Version 0.3.14 ist dies (bei mir) in Zeile 1067 (dort auch ändern??)

                    unter /opt/iobroker/node_modules/iobroker.js-controller/lib

                    wobei /opt/iobroker aus Gewohnheit mein Installationsverzeichnis ist

                    Gruß

                    Rainer `
                    Ja. 0.3.14 Auch betroffen

                    1 Reply Last reply Reply Quote 0
                    • Homoran
                      Homoran Global Moderator Administrators last edited by

                      Habe Änderung eingegeben.

                      über putty iobroker update aufgerufen

                      Version 0.3.15 vorhanden

                      über admin, reiter hosts update durchgeführt

                      Anzeige: neueste Version 0.3.15 installiert 0.3.15 (0.3.14 running)

                      über icon ./iobroker restart

                      keine Änderung!

                      reboot des cubie

                      ./iobroker start ohne Probleme; sogar ohne chmod +x!!

                      iobroker daemon startet mit PID xxxx

                      aber über IP:8081 nicht aufrufbar!

                      Gruß

                      Rainer

                      PS werde gleich geändertes installscript testen, wenn keine weiteren Wünsche von dir kommen

                      1 Reply Last reply Reply Quote 0
                      • First post
                        Last post

                      Support us

                      ioBroker
                      Community Adapters
                      Donate
                      FAQ Cloud / IOT
                      HowTo: Node.js-Update
                      HowTo: Backup/Restore
                      Downloads
                      BLOG

                      1.1k
                      Online

                      31.7k
                      Users

                      79.7k
                      Topics

                      1.3m
                      Posts

                      2
                      9
                      3210
                      Loading More Posts
                      • Oldest to Newest
                      • Newest to Oldest
                      • Most Votes
                      Reply
                      • Reply as topic
                      Log in to reply
                      Community
                      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                      The ioBroker Community 2014-2023
                      logo